Transaction 86b37448be23ad870b7919afa6f84c8b4db610a0ae7832158eeaa122cad8dd17
1 Input
2 Outputs
- 86b37448be23ad870b7919afa6f84c8b4db610a0ae7832158eeaa122cad8dd17:0
- 86b37448be23ad870b7919afa6f84c8b4db610a0ae7832158eeaa122cad8dd17:1
value 42990000
address 1FzMsrFirmQEUrwPvbNFN6aeDBXzPcqkrX
value 17000000
address 1KsPGi9tyzUKStdggKFHtvzHr2XnRnF4um